What is the primary function of the Bus Interface Controller (BIC) in the MAU board?

To connect client modules to the backplane bus through a dual-port RAM

What type of memory is used in the Bus Interface Controller (BIC) frame buffer?

Random Access Memory

What is the purpose of the Aircraft Personality Modules (APMs) in the NIC modules?

To store system identification data, options data, system settings data, and rigging data

What is the primary function of the software firewalls in the MAU?

To protect the MAU from malicious data originating from other applications

What is the primary purpose of the ADCN implementing a redundant network with both network A and B?

To ensure that a data path is still established in the event of a switch failure

What type of data bus is used in the MAU for data processing and operations?

Avionics Standard-Communication Bus (ASCB) and Local Area Network (LAN) bus

What is the function of the ASCB coupler in the MAU?

To terminate the ASCB data bus

What happens when a subscriber receives two identical data frames from network A and B?

The subscriber rejects one of the frames and uses the other

What is the function of the auto-switching system in the ADCN network?

To automatically switch to a redundant network in the event of a failure

What is the purpose of the Avionics Standard-Communication Bus (ASCB) in AIOP modules?

To collect data from avionic and flight control systems

What type of connector is used in the core processing input/output modules?

ARINC 600 connector

What is the function of the Linear Variable Differential Transformers (LVDTs)?

To provide analogue feedback to the Primary Actuator Control Electronics (P-ACE) System

What is the role of the Flight Control Module (FCM) in the autopilot system?

To receive yaw damper and turn coordination signals from the FGCS

What is the primary benefit of the ADCN network's redundant design?

Improved network reliability and fault tolerance

What is the purpose of the Controller Area Network (CAN) bus in the autopilot system?

To transmit digital feedback data from the P-ACE System to the AIOP modules

What is the significance of the two AIOP modules in each channel?

They have the same software but perform separate and complementary functions

What is the relationship between the AIOP modules in lane A and lane B?

They must operate at the same time for the servos in that channel to be active and engaged

What is the primary function of the Modular Avionics Unit (MAU) in the Embraer 170/190 aircraft?

To host independent applications and supply an input/output interface service

What is the purpose of the Line Replaceable Modules (LRM) in the Modular Avionics Unit (MAU)?

To make contact with a virtual backplane bus for power and communication

What is the advantage of having two independent processing systems (channels) in each MAU?

To provide redundancy in the event of a failure

How do the Modular Avionics Units (MAU) connect to the aircraft system wiring?

Through the front connectors on the LRM

What is the purpose of the backplane in the MAU?

To make contact with a virtual backplane bus for power and communication

What is the physical structure of the Modular Avionics Unit (MAU)?

A metal cabinet solidly grounded to the aircraft frame

What is the primary function of ASCB terminators?

To absorb signals to prevent reflection

What type of cable is used in the Local Area Network (LAN)?

Thin coaxial cable

What is the frequency of operation of the Controller Area Network (CAN) bus?

500 kHz

What protocol is used in the Local Area Network (LAN)?

TCP/IP

What is the purpose of the Local Area Network (LAN)?

For development, maintenance and software loading

What device controls data transmission on the Local Area Network (LAN)?

NIC
